Plot:
When a college student (Annalisa Kyler) dissappears along the road, her friends quickly form a search party to find the lost woman. Unfortunately, these college slackers (Martin Seijo, Lauren Brown & Kayte Giralt) are in way over their heads. Also trying to piece this mystery together is the local Sheriff (Allan Medina) and the coroner (Ed Donovan). Womanizing jerk Bruce (Michael Thomas Dunn) and tomboy Vanessa (Carrie Grafton) decide to tag along for the wild ride. Bloody 27 is a campy horror/comedy with a similar tone to the Hatchet or Toxic Avenger films. So if you want to laugh and scream at the same time, this may just be the movie you are looking for!
